Bug description:
After upgrading to kmod (24-1ubuntu3.1) the trackpads stop working on
Lenovo 11e 2nd gen machines.
We have a fleet of approximetly 1000 of them in production running
ubuntu 18.04. Prior to this update the trackpads worked out of box in
18.04.
We are currently working around the issue by deploying our own
blacklist files.
